    Finding Us

    We are in easy reach from various methods of transport:


    Bus
    94, 237, 266. 207, 260, 283, 228


    Underground
    Goldhawk Road (Hammersmith and City Line), Ravenscourt Park (District Line)


    Car
    Limited parking is available at Hammersmith Academy. Visitors are encouraged to travel via public transport.

    Should you choose to travel by car please be advised that on street parking is available at a cost of £1.10 per half hour (as of April 2013) chargeable between the hours of 9.00am to 5.00pm (Mon-Fri).

Music

7 – 11 Music

Music is the art of manipulating emotion through sound. That is so powerful, to be able to change how other people feel and, in the process, yourself as well

Ms Slav (Head of Music)

GCSE

Exam Board: OCR

Qualification: GCSE Music

Assessment breakdown:

  • Listening examination: 40%
  • Performing: 30%
  • Composing: 30%

Music at Hammersmith Academy aims for students to gain the confidence to perform to others, compose their own pieces and gain a knowledge of different styles and cultures through music. Students will focus on performances and compositions in a range of styles such as African, Gamelan, Pop and Blues. They will develop listening and appraising, composing and performance skills throughout KS3 as well as develop vitally important transferable skills such as self-discipline, team work and leadership.

At GCSE, students continue to develop their three core skills of listening and appraising, composing and performing. They will deepen their knowledge of music theory and learn a variety of musical styles within the 4 main areas of study: Rhythms of the World; Concerto Through Time; Film and Video Game Music; Conventions of Pop.
